From the pictures I took of my Dungeons & Dragons game last week, I got a pretty good shot from behind the Dungeon Master Screen. I thought I would explain a little about what I have going on here.
View From Behind the DM Screen
The Dungeons & Dragons 4.0 Screen
Bottle caps I use to indicate if a player is prone or bloodied for example
Funky looking pencil sharpener
Dice
A Full pencil box.
Monster Tokens from the Dungeons & Dragons Starter Set. Helps represent monster locations on the battlemat
Miniatures used for represent good and bad guys.
Wet erase markers for the battlemat
legal pad used as scratch paper for notes and initiative order.
Gridded notebook containing Maps and notes of a particular adventure.
A box containing index cards. On the cards will be written items in a particular store or even in hidden treasures.
